Transaction 88174329cecafc71d372aa4d56395eaf25c4c51f61bf63593458f49ef4059aa2
1 Input
1 Output
-
88174329cecafc71d372aa4d56395eaf25c4c51f61bf63593458f49ef4059aa2:0
- value
- 115966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d01c6c3a344a73bba7aded1ed3d752dad78ea7b OP_EQUAL
- address
- 3LNzaJBNRGJ2ygbjGZfERH99QPwuuy1byK